The Joshua Centre opened in 2022 and is a special purpose built educational facility for autistic students. The Joshua Centre is located within the Tyabb Campus and provides a differentiated learning program and universally designed environment, to cater and support to differing sensory profiles. We seek to see autistic students not just survive, but instead thrive, be bold and courageous in their learning, social connection and wellbeing in order to live a full and purposeful life.

Flinders Christian Community College is a co-educational, non–denominational College with campuses located at Tyabb, Carrum Downs, and Mt. Martha offering education from K – 12.

Flinders seeks to achieve long term educational outcomes related to student understanding and dispositions for life-long learning.  The Christian values of the school provide a stable foundation for living in a changing world, and equip students to face the challenges of life with hope and purpose for the future.
